Nick Kwaterski second time winner at Red Putter Pro


United States of America 11 Aug 2011 at 06:31 | Published by: Blondie | Views: 13905 | News search

Nick Kwaterski second time winner at Red Putter Pro
Last years winner fitting the coat on the new champion.  (Photo by Astra Miglane-Stanwyck 2011)

Tenth Annual Red Putter Pro gathered 72 players from all over country. Players had to qualify for event playing round of 41 or less on par 42 course.

The tournament opening round put on leadership board Nate Gomoll with 33 (only 2 strokes less then course record set by Mark Schroeder- 2009 Red Putter Pro winner), Matthew McCaslin 34, Paul Nelson 35, followed by score 36 from Nick Kwaterski, Mark Schroeder and Michael Hayford.

After two rounds Matthew McCaslin was leading with 70 points, followed by Nick-71, Nate Gomoll 72, Chris Hookers 73, and Daniel McCaslin 74 and Paul Nelson 74.

Competition was tight and after three rounds Nick was leading by one point, leaving Matthew in 2nd place. Chris Hookers finished his last round with 34 earning 3rd place.

USD 1500 was prize money for 1st along with winners Red Jacket, 500 for second place and 100 for 3rd. Best round also was awarded USD 100 which resulted in sudden death replay for best round between Chris Hookers and Nate Gomoll. Both players tied on Bear hole but winning ace was achieved by Chris earning him extra USD 100 and trophy.

All winners and lady players were awarded Red Putter Pro player polo shirts.
